Output 529b03e72e0015ae7210d714c4494421d5cdfd349ea515efcf323ae1a04832f4:2

value
1265000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d5410f3453737e27e6472b328bc8936b9649242 OP_EQUAL
address
3EaHucbwwLjEu1SN2VVyJBY6tjncxLU6iK
transaction
529b03e72e0015ae7210d714c4494421d5cdfd349ea515efcf323ae1a04832f4
spent
true